Diet Control Assistant
About The Role
The primary purpose of the Diet Control Assistant position is to provide infant, pediatric, adolescent, adult and geriatric patients with quality Food & Nutrition services, operational information; and serves as the liaison between the patient care unit(s) and the Department of Food & Nutrition. Delivers all meals/food items to infant, pediatric, adolescent, adult and geriatric patients in designated patient care unit(s) within specified time frames. Performs in a caring, conscientious and confidential manner toward patients, family members, visitors, colleagues, staff and students. Maintains individual patient care electronic Card files and coordinates interdepartmental communications.
Responsibilities
- Maintains electronic patient card files.
- Modifies menu to comply with diet order prescriptions/meal patterns.
- Formulates patient meal supplements and nourishments.
- Delivers meals and snacks per policy and procedures.
- Retrieves patient meal trays per policy and procedure.
- Utilizes knowledge of growth and development when providing services to infant, pediatric, adolescent, adult and geriatric patients.
- Communicates with infant, pediatric, adolescent, adult and geriatric patients in a manner which demonstrates an understanding of the patient’s developmental and cognitive level.
- Calculates production requirements for meals, including tallied items.
